May is National Mental Health Month
By Syracuse Community Health CenterPosted on 05/06/13Pathways to Wellness-this year's theme for May is Mental Health Month-calls attention to strategies and approaches that help all Americans achieve wellness and good mental and overall health.
Wellness is essential to living a full and productive life. We may have different ideas about what wellness means, but it involves a set of skills and strategies to prevent the onset or shorten the duration of illness and promote recovery and well-being. It's about keeping healthy as well as getting healthy and is more than absence of disease.
